With all that in mind, is is essential that some really interesting and boundary driving ideas are utilised when creating this space.


Maybe through the means of a creative, sound-proofing, plastic bottled wall? Easy to acquire, cheap, "different", creative and above all, ecologically, economically and environmentally friendly.


Alternatively, recycling glass wine bottles can be as effective, if not more so. A little more expensive, whether that be through acquiring them or drinking your way through them! plastic bottles are obviously a lot flexible in terms of portability; the glass bottles being more of a tool for more solid and permanent walling which is not something the space requires, but could, possibly benefit from.
